Rosie O'Donnell Says She's 'Not Fazed' by Trump's Threat To Revoke Her U.S. Citizenship-as She Brands President 'the Tangerine Mussolini'
Briefly

Rosie O'Donnell, in response to President Trump's threat of revoking her U.S. citizenship, claimed she is unfazed by his comments and labeled him a "tangerine Mussolini." O'Donnell moved to Ireland in early 2025 after Trump's victory in the 2024 election, stating she is "safe" there. Trump branded her a "threat to humanity" on social media, which prompted her to post a defiance statement on Instagram. In a TikTok video, she reaffirmed her commitment to critique him, vowing not to renounce her citizenship nor silence herself on his actions.
Rosie O'Donnell stated, "I have to say that I was expecting him to do something as absurd as he did, for a few reasons."
O'Donnell emphasized, "I'm not yours to silence. I never was."
She affirmed her status by saying, "I'm good, I'm safe here in Ireland. I'm out of the reach of the tangerine Mussolini."
Trump referred to O'Donnell as a "threat to humanity" and declared that she is not in the best interests of the country.
